Challenge Your Drone Skills with an Exciting Obstacle Course

 An obstacle course for drones is a set of challenges designed to test the skills and capabilities of the drone and its operator. These courses can range from simple, straight-line courses with a few obstacles to complex, multi-level courses with a variety of obstacles and challenges. Some common obstacles that may be included in a drone obstacle course include:


Gates: These are typically placed in a straight line and require the drone to fly through them without touching the gate or knocking it down.


Tunnels: These can be made of PVC pipes or other materials and require the drone to fly through them without touching the sides.


Hoops: These are typically circular obstacles that the drone must fly through without touching the sides.


Balances: These are typically beams or platforms that the drone must land on and remain balanced on for a specified period of time.


Targets: These are typically circular or square targets that the drone must hover over or land on for a specified period of time.


To set up a drone obstacle course, you will need a flat, open area with plenty of space for the drone to maneuver. You will also need a variety of obstacles, such as gates, tunnels, hoops, balances, and targets. You can either purchase these items or make them yourself using materials such as PVC pipes, wooden beams, and cardboard boxes. Once you have set up the course, you can then fly your drone through the obstacles and see how well it performs.
